Output 37857480bdf7506811d4abeaf856cf70e11b0261af58119c7d529b0e1beda4cd:1

value
2704426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fc5a2717dadf398308329b6b0ae172a96cc31d OP_EQUAL
address
32bpK1HAmDmeyv3X1srgHALX5gCe9o8Mo4
transaction
37857480bdf7506811d4abeaf856cf70e11b0261af58119c7d529b0e1beda4cd
spent
true